The first reference of its kind, Great Books for Girls is
an invaluable list of more than six hundred titles--picture
books, novels, mysteries, biographies, folktales, sports
books, and more--that will encourage, challenge, and
ultimately nurture in girls the strong qualities our
culture
so often suppresses.  
Kathleen Odean, a librarian and former member of the
prestigious Caldecott and Newbery Award committees, has
gathered and annotated a list of books starring bold,
confident heroines for children from toddlers to age
fourteen.  Here are old favorites such as Eloise,
Harriet the Spy, Mrs.  Basil E. Frankweiler, and Ramona the
Pest; new inspirations such as Cinder Edna, Sheila Rae the
Brave, Herculeah Jones, and Princess Smartypants; and
real-life admirable women such as Eleanor of
Aquitaine, Jane Goodall, Toni Morrison, Eleanor Roosevelt,
and Helen Keller.

In these books, girls and women are creative, capable,
articulate, and intelligent, solving problems, facing
challenges, resolving conflicts, and going on quests.  They
are not sidekicks or tokens, waiting to be rescued;
they are doing the rescuing.  Nor are they waiting for a
male to provide a happy ending; they are fashioning their
own stories and their own endings.  Packed with expert
guidance,Great Books for Girls is an essential volume that
will give girls of all ages the power of hope.
